PDF转Excel:高效数据提取与格式转换的完整指南
引言:为什么需要将PDF转为Excel?
在日常工作和学习中,我们经常会遇到需要从PDF文件中提取数据并整理成表格的情况。PDF文件虽然便于分享和阅读,但其固定格式使得数据编辑和分析变得困难。将PDF转换为Excel表格可以让我们轻松地进行数据排序、计算和可视化处理。
PDF转Excel的主要方法
1. 在线转换工具
在线转换工具是最便捷的PDF转Excel方法之一,无需安装软件,只需上传文件即可完成转换。推荐工具包括:
- Adobe Acrobat在线服务:Adobe官方提供的在线转换工具,转换质量高
- Smallpdf:支持批量转换,界面简洁易用
- iLovePDF:提供免费转换服务,支持多种文件格式
2. 桌面软件解决方案
对于需要频繁转换或处理敏感文件的用户,桌面软件是更好的选择:
- Adobe Acrobat Pro:专业级PDF处理软件,转换准确度最高
- Wondershare PDFelement:功能全面,性价比高
- Nitro Pro:企业级解决方案,支持批量处理
3. 编程实现方案
对于技术用户,可以使用编程语言实现PDF到Excel的转换:
# Python示例代码
import pdfplumber
import pandas as pd
with pdfplumber.open('document.pdf') as pdf:
for page in pdf.pages:
table = page.extract_table()
df = pd.DataFrame(table)
df.to_excel('output.xlsx', index=False)
转换前的准备建议
为了获得最佳转换效果,建议在转换前进行以下准备:
- 检查PDF质量:确保PDF文件清晰可读,扫描件需先进行OCR识别
- 了解PDF结构:区分文本PDF和图像PDF,选择对应的转换策略
- 备份原文件:转换前备份重要文件,防止数据丢失
常见问题与解决方案
问题1:转换后排版混乱
解决方案:使用支持表格识别的高级转换工具,或在转换后手动调整Excel格式。
问题2:中文字符显示异常
解决方案:确保转换工具支持中文编码,或先尝试将PDF转换为文本再导入Excel。
问题3:扫描件PDF无法识别
解决方案:使用带OCR功能的转换工具,如Adobe Acrobat的OCR功能或ABBYY FineReader。
保持数据完整性的技巧
- 转换后立即检查数据准确性,特别是数字和日期格式
- 使用Excel的数据验证功能确保数据格式一致
- 对于重要数据,建议人工复核关键字段
- 保存转换设置模板,便于后续相同类型文件的批量处理
总结
PDF转Excel虽然看似简单,但选择合适的方法和工具对结果质量有重要影响。根据文件类型、数据量大小和安全要求,选择最适合的转换方案。随着人工智能技术的发展,未来的PDF转换工具将更加智能,能够更好地保持原始排版和识别复杂表格结构。
无论您选择哪种方法,建议先在小样本文件上测试转换效果,再进行大批量处理。同时,定期更新转换工具以获得最新的功能和更好的转换质量。